iPhone got wet? Here are some best tips to dry out your wet iPhone and prevent damage

Discovering that your iPhone has encountered moisture can be distressing, but taking swift action can help prevent potential damage. Whether it's from accidental immersion or exposure to rain, knowing the right steps to dry out your device is crucial. Here are some recommended tips to effectively dry out a wet iPhone and minimise the risk of damage:

If your iPhone is connected to any cables or accessories, unplug it immediately. This prevents any potential short circuits or electrical damage.

Lightly tap your iPhone against your hand, ensuring the connector is facing downwards. This can help dislodge any trapped water or moisture from the device.

  • Air Dry in a Well-Ventilated Area

Place your iPhone in a dry place with adequate airflow. Avoiding enclosed spaces allows the moisture to evaporate more effectively.

Resist the urge to power on or charge your iPhone immediately. Allow at least 30 minutes for the device to air dry naturally.

  • Check for Residual Moisture

If the liquid alert persists or returns, there may still be moisture in the connector or under the pins of your cable. Continue air drying for up to a day to ensure thorough drying.

If your iPhone remains unresponsive or fails to charge after drying, attempt to disconnect and reconnect the charging cable and adapter. This action could potentially address any remaining concerns.

  • Avoid Heat Sources and Foreign Objects

Do not attempt to dry your iPhone using external heat sources like hair dryers or heaters. High temperatures can damage internal components. Similarly, avoid inserting foreign objects such as cotton swabs or paper towels into the connector, as this can cause further damage.

  • Seek Professional Assistance if Necessary

If your iPhone still exhibits issues after drying, consider seeking assistance from an authorised Apple service provider or technician. They are capable of evaluating the degree of harm and offering suitable remedies.
